diff --git a/ffplayout-frontend b/ffplayout-frontend index c02141af..0dcd1646 160000 --- a/ffplayout-frontend +++ b/ffplayout-frontend @@ -1 +1 @@ -Subproject commit c02141af54762961cf559248a3c9d42e9d317e0b +Subproject commit 0dcd1646938a6ec66573c057ef959ffd000eff5c diff --git a/scripts/build_all.sh b/scripts/build_all.sh index 725376b1..e8a88f3f 100755 --- a/scripts/build_all.sh +++ b/scripts/build_all.sh @@ -1,5 +1,13 @@ #!/usr/bin/bash +cd ffplayout-frontend + +npm install +npm run build +yes | rm -rf ../public +mv dist ../public + +cd .. targets=("x86_64-unknown-linux-musl" "aarch64-unknown-linux-gnu" "x86_64-pc-windows-gnu" "x86_64-apple-darwin" "aarch64-apple-darwin") @@ -54,15 +62,6 @@ for target in "${targets[@]}"; do echo "" done -cd ffplayout-frontend - -npm install -npm run build -yes | rm -rf ../public -mv dist ../public - -cd .. - cargo deb --target=x86_64-unknown-linux-musl -p ffplayout --manifest-path=ffplayout-engine/Cargo.toml -o ffplayout_${version}_amd64.deb cargo deb --target=aarch64-unknown-linux-gnu --variant=arm64 -p ffplayout --manifest-path=ffplayout-engine/Cargo.toml -o ffplayout_${version}_arm64.deb